Car Keys Lost and Found

Car keys are expensive to replace. The cost of replacing keys for cars varies based on the type and manufacturer.

Older vehicles use metal keys which can be duplicated by a locksmith or hardware store. As cars become more technologically advanced and technology, they're more difficult to replace if lost.

1. Go to the Dealership

You can purchase a brand new car key from the dealership when you own a car. This could be a good alternative if your key isn't working as it should or has been damaged in the ignition. You can get a brand new key, but it will cost more than calling an auto locksmith.

It may take longer than going to a locksmith. If the dealer doesn't have the key on hand they'll have to purchase it. It could take a few days for it to arrive. Also, they might need to pay for towing costs to deliver your vehicle.

A dealership is a business with a lot of overheads, including management and staff. This is a reason why their costs are more expensive than an auto locksmith. If you're looking to replace your key immediately it could be the only choice.

2. Locksmiths are on call 24 hours a day

young-couple-holding-the-keys-of-a-new-cIf your car keys go missing it can cause a huge trouble. If you don't have a spare key you will need to order an entirely new one, which can be costly. You can do this in various ways, but the most effective is to contact an automotive locksmith. They can make you an entirely new key on the spot, and are typically less expensive than going to the dealership.

The cost of replacing your car keys will depend on the type of key you own. Classic cars have keys that are simple to insert into the cylinder of ignition. It is possible to find an alternative for less than $10 at any hardware store, however it's more complicated on modern vehicles, which generally include remote locking and unlocking systems. They require a specific kind of key fob that can also be used to do things such as open the trunk or start the engine. These are more difficult to replace, lost Car keys replacement cost Uk but they can be done by a professional locksmith for cars who has the required equipment and software.

You could also call garages however they're likely be more expensive than a locksmith. They may lack the appropriate equipment to program your keys, which is tricky and time-consuming. A professional automotive locksmith will have the proper tools and know how to do this fast.

You can also try roadside assistance. These services are generally provided by car insurance providers but they might or may not be able to help you. They're likely to be more expensive than a locksmith, and they might not have the proper equipment for your specific vehicle.
